Dan Rather's topless Emmy sells for $2,499!

December 24, 2007 | 10:27 pm

The last time I asked Dan Rather how many news Emmys he's won, he didn't know. The National RatheremmyAcademy of Television Arts & Sciences doesn't know either because it doesn't bother to maintain a searchable database of past winners like all other top award groups do. In Rather's case, he's won so many that it's easy to lose count — somewhere south of 20 but north of 10 is my best guess. But lately he has one less, whether he knows it or not. (Often these things get lifted.) One of his Emmys — a most curious one — just sold on Ebay for $2,499, an excellent price considering TV's Golden Girl is missing the spinning electron she holds aloft. (It's not a globe, as noted in the Ebay listing.) I don't know how to reach Rather these days since he's no longer at CBS. If you do, please send him this link — CLICK HERE
